Programme Overview
The Advanced Certificate in Discrete Math for Computer Network Analysis is designed for professionals and aspiring computer scientists who wish to deepen their understanding of discrete mathematics as applied to computer network analysis. The programme covers essential topics such as graph theory, combinatorics, logic, and set theory, with a strong focus on their practical applications in network design, security, and performance optimization. It also introduces advanced concepts like algorithmic complexity and network protocols, providing a robust foundation for those aiming to enhance their analytical and problem-solving skills in the field of computer networks.
Learners in this programme will develop key skills in mathematical reasoning, algorithm design, and network analysis. They will gain proficiency in using discrete mathematics to model and solve real-world problems related to network traffic, security vulnerabilities, and data routing. Through hands-on exercises and case studies, participants will learn to apply mathematical theories to design efficient and secure network architectures, evaluate network performance, and troubleshoot issues using analytical tools.

Topics Covered
- Graph Theory Fundamentals: Introduces basic graph theory concepts and their applications in network analysis.: Combinatorial Methods: Teaches combinatorial techniques for solving complex network problems.
- Probability and Statistics: Covers essential probability and statistical methods for network analysis.: Algorithm Design: Focuses on designing efficient algorithms for network-related tasks.
- Network Flow Analysis: Examines methods for analyzing flow in networks, including max-flow min-cut theorem.: Cryptography Basics: Provides an introduction to cryptographic techniques and their use in secure network analysis.
